[QUOTE="burton666, post: 796227, member: 19144"] I have now been able to solve my problem with some help from from TBS support. Using DVB-dream and entering custom HEX codes in the RAW DiSEqC option of each satellite. How can I enter these HEX commands in Tv-server? This is the mail I recieved from support: i believe it's just issue related to your multiswitch - as far as i can understand form the article here: [url=http://www.mythtv.org/wiki/MultiLNB_Switch_Setup]MultiLNB Switch Setup - MythTV[/url] EMP-154AP Multiswitch uses DiSEqC A and B ("committed") commands for selecting between the 2 groups of 4 ports - respectively group 1 (port A, B, C, D) and group 2 (port E, F, G, H), then in each group it uses 22 kHz tone to select between first and second half of ports in the the group - for example 22 kHz tone off selects ports (A, B) or sub-group 1 and 22 kHz tone on selects ports (C, D) or sub-group 2 in group 1 and at the end it uses voltage to select select port in a sub-group - for example 18V selects port B and 13V selects port A in sub-group 1. so, that allows with one Quan LNB connected for example to ports A, B, C, and D to cover all 4 options: low-band, Vertical; low-band, Horizontal; high-band Vertical; high-band, Horizontal; so, have you configured for example DVBDream to use your switch - i believe based on the above you need to do: * go to Option Menu --> Diseqc * set "Diseqc Switch Type" to "v1.0 or v2.0" * double click on "Port X", assigned satellite and choose "Raw Diseqc", which allows you to manually input what DiSEqC command to be sent by DVBDream when choose that satellite - please look at the attached picture: - dvbdream_diseqc_port1.png then repeat the same steps for the other satellite using "E0 10 38 F4" as DiSEqC command, because "E0 10 38 F0" and "E0 10 38 F4" are respectively DiSEqC A and B for "committed" type of switch. please, let me know if the above helps - at least at the moment i assume the issue is related to the switch.
